Knew what, exactly? That groups of tickets for stadium shows would begin to be released as the event got closer?

I knew that too, just as I knew the sun would rise in the east this morning.

For a hundred different valid reasons and especially for stadium events promoters always hold lots of tickets, then release chunks as things become more defined closer to the date.

Nothing nefarious to see here, just the normal workings of putting on huge reserved seat stadium shows.

BTW, if there were any at the lowest price for the SF shows they're gone now, because the other predictable part of this situation is that despite the games TM plays to stop this, the pro scalpers have their systems running 24/7, then they quickly inhale most anything that gets released.

And Ken, the Gorge is smaller and is a set venue so they're not holding & releasing large numbers of tix the same way, especially if the shows are full GA, so there won't be many face value tix released, but there almost certainly will be some, so keep your eyes open and good luck.
